The acceptance of credit earned at another institution and applied to an OHSU academic program at the same course level will be based on the quality of the institution from which the student transfers; assessment of the comparability and relevance to the OHSU program; grade received in each course; any articulation agreements between OHSU and another academic institution. Relevant credit may be accepted from any institution accredited by an accreditor that was recognized by the Council for Higher Education Accreditation or the U.S. Department of Education at the time the credits were awarded. Transfer credits are evaluated without regard for delivery method and include courses completed in-person or remotely, and synchronously or asynchronously.


Acceptance of credit in transfer is governed by OHSU policies 02-70-005 (Transfer of Course Credit) and 02-50-055 (Enrollment of Students in Multiple Degree/Certificate Offerings). Before authorizing the transfer of coursework, school officials are responsible for ensuring that the resulting transfer aligns will all policy requirements, including maximum transfer credits accepted and maximum age of transfer coursework.


For graduate programs, no more than 1/3 of credit hours toward degree requirements can be transferred from another accredited academic institution without prior approval of the dean and provost. For undergraduate programs, a minimum of 45 credits must be completed in residence at OHSU. In all instances, only earned credit can be transferred; grade point average (GPA) does not transfer.


Finally, all transferable credits must have been earned in the last 7 years. No courses completed >7 years ago are eligible for credit at OHSU.
